There are many meanings of the word immigrant such as theoretical, administrative or statistical. In the strictly theoretical way, an immigrant is the person who is born in a specific country but his parents has foreign origins or the person who crosses the border of a particular country with the intention of remaining there. In other words, a person is an immigrant when he or she becomes a part of one country population by other methods than by birth. The statistical and administrative meanings of the word immigrant very much vary and depend on the immigration laws and administrative decisions of a country.
